Route Logistics and Infrastructure

The recommended route uses the A61 (Albi to Carcassonne), then A9/A7 via Nîmes, then A8 to Menton. Toll costs total around €50. Fuel stations are plentiful along the autoroutes, but become sparse between Carcassonne and Nîmes on secondary roads. Fill up in Albi or Carcassonne to avoid price surges.

  • Toll roads: A61 (Toulouse direction), A9, A8 – accept credit cards.
  • Alternative free route: N113 through Castelnaudary, then D999 via Aix-en-Provence – longer but scenic.
  • Fuel efficiency: expect higher consumption in the climb from Aix to Cannes (5.5-6.0 L/100km in the Luberon).
  • Parking in Menton: use underground garages near the old town (€15/day).

Road Safety, Family Stops, and Fatigue Management

The A61 and A8 are well-maintained with rest areas every 20 km. However, the A9 through the Rhône valley can be windy (mistral) – reduce speed when strong wind warnings appear. Night illumination is good on motorways but poor on secondary roads like the D6 near Grasse. Always carry a fluorescent vest and warning triangle in the car.
